Miss Europe 1984 was the 43rd edition of the Miss Europe pageant and the 32nd edition under the Mondial Events Organization. It was held in Badgastein, Austria on February 17, 1984. Neşe Erberk of Turkey, was crowned Miss Europe 1984 by out going titleholder Nazlı Deniz Kuruoğlu of Turkey.

Contestants
[edit]Austria - Mercedes Stermitz
Belgium - Françoise Bostoen
Cyprus - Katia Chrysochou
Denmark - Tina-Lissette Dahl Jørgensen
England - Karen Lesley Moore
Finland - Sanna Marita Pekkala
France - Frédérique Leroy
Germany - Loana Katharina Radecki
Gibraltar - Giselle Ruiz
Greece - Plousia "Sia" Farfaraki
Holland - Nancy Lalleman-Heijnis[1]
Iceland - Kristín Ingvadóttir
Ireland - Patricia "Trish" Nolan
Italy - Ambra Pellino
Malta - Jennifer Schembri
Norway - Janne Knutsen
Poland - Lidia Wasiak
Portugal - Anabela Elisa Vissenjou Ananíades
Scotland - Linda Renton
Spain - Garbiñe Abásolo García
Sweden - Viveca Miriam Ljung
Switzerland - Corinne Martin
Turkey - Neşe Erberk
Wales - Lianne Patricia Gray[2]
Yugoslavia - Jadranka Mitrovic
